Distance From Cork Airport to Miami International Airport (ORK - MIA Distance)

The flight distance from Cork Airport (ORK) to Miami International Airport (MIA) is 4073 miles. This is equivalent to 6554 kilometers or 3537 nautical miles. The distance shown below is the straight line distance (may be called as flying or air distance) or direct flight distance between airports.

Flight Duration between Cork, Ireland and Miami (MIA), United States

Estimated flight time from Cork Airport, Cork, Ireland to Miami International Airport, Miami (MIA), United States is 8 hours 9 minutes under avarage conditions. The flight time calculator assumes an average flight speed for a commercial airliner of 500 mph, which is equivalent to 805 km/hr or 434 knots. Your actual flying time may vary depending on wind speeds or weather conditions.
